Photo gallery: Selena Gomez in concert in Salt Lake City

Selena Gomez's Stars Dance Tour stopped in Salt Lake on Thursday to support the singer's first solo album.

The opening acts, YouTube sensation Christina Grimmie and boy band Emblem 3, stoked a crowd that was already wild.

Gomez opened with "Bang Bang Bang" from her last album, recorded with her band Selena Gomez & the Scene. Her riveting performance included old and new favorites. Songs such as "Naturally" and "Love You Like a Love Song" flowed between new hits "Come & Get It" and "Love Will Remember."

She also performed "Who Says," a crowd favorite that inspired young girls to sing along as loudly as they could. She capped the performance with "Slow Down" from the album that inspired the tour's name.
